在机械加工领域,攻丝是一种常见的加工方式,它涉及到将螺纹加工到材料表面。Mastercam作为一款功能强大的CAD/CAM软件,在攻丝编程方面具有显著优势。掌握Mastercam攻丝编程技巧,不仅能提高加工效率,还能保证加工精度。下面,我们就来详细探讨一下如何在Mastercam中实现这一目标。
一、了解攻丝编程的基本概念
在Mastercam中,攻丝编程主要包括以下几个步骤:
- 选择合适的攻丝刀具:根据加工材料和螺纹规格选择合适的刀具,确保加工质量。
- 设置攻丝参数:包括螺纹深度、切削参数、进给率等,这些参数直接影响到加工效果。
- 编写攻丝程序:在Mastercam中,通过编写G代码实现攻丝过程。
二、掌握攻丝编程技巧
1. 熟练使用Mastercam软件
熟练掌握Mastercam软件是进行攻丝编程的基础。以下是一些实用的技巧:
- 熟悉软件界面:熟悉Mastercam的各个功能模块,如刀具库、加工参数设置等。
- 掌握基本操作:如创建刀具路径、设置加工参数、编写G代码等。
2. 选择合适的攻丝刀具
选择合适的攻丝刀具是保证加工质量的关键。以下是一些选择刀具的技巧:
- 根据加工材料选择刀具材质:如加工钢件,可选择高速钢刀具;加工铝件,可选择硬质合金刀具。
- 根据螺纹规格选择刀具尺寸:确保刀具尺寸与螺纹规格相匹配。
3. 设置攻丝参数
设置攻丝参数是影响加工效果的重要因素。以下是一些设置攻丝参数的技巧:
- 确定螺纹深度:根据螺纹规格和加工材料确定螺纹深度。
- 设置切削参数:如切削速度、进给率等,根据刀具和加工材料选择合适的参数。
- 设置安全参数:如刀具切入和切出位置、加工余量等,确保加工安全。
4. 编写攻丝程序
编写攻丝程序是攻丝编程的核心。以下是一些编写攻丝程序的技巧:
- 使用G代码编程:掌握G代码的基本语法和常用指令,如G21(设置单位为毫米)、G28(返回参考点)等。
- 编写攻丝循环:使用Mastercam的攻丝循环功能,简化编程过程。
三、实例分析
以下是一个使用Mastercam进行攻丝编程的实例:
- 选择刀具:选择一把适合加工材料的攻丝刀具。
- 设置攻丝参数:根据螺纹规格和加工材料设置螺纹深度、切削参数等。
- 编写攻丝程序:
O1000
G21
G90
G28 X0 Y0
G0 X0 Y0
G0 Z1
G28 Z0
G0 Z-5
G43 H1
G0 Z-2
G98 G81 X0 Y0 Z-5 F1000 S1000
G0 Z1
G28 H1
M30
该程序实现了攻丝加工过程,其中G81为攻丝循环指令,X0 Y0为攻丝起点,Z-5为螺纹深度,F1000为进给率,S1000为主轴转速。
四、总结
掌握Mastercam攻丝编程技巧,能够有效提高加工效率与精度。通过以上介绍,相信您已经对Mastercam攻丝编程有了更深入的了解。在实际操作中,不断积累经验,优化编程技巧,定能成为一名优秀的CAD/CAM工程师。
